The Beat Road

KNIGHT, Arthur, and Kit, eds.

KNIGHT, Arthur, and Kit, eds.

California, PA: The Unspeakable Visions of the Individual, 1984. 67pp; b&w photo-illus. Photo-illustrated wraps. Light wear and soiling to covers, toning to edges of textblock. Very good or better.

A collection of writings by and about members of the Beat Generation. Contents include a preface by John Clellon Holmes; a prose remembrance of Kerouac by Paul Krassner; a Kerouac letter to Allen Ginsberg; an interview of Diane di Prima by Anne Waldman; a Gregory Corso letter to Gary Snyder; a prose sketch of Times Square by Allen Ginsberg; etc. Black-and-white photo-illustrations and drawings throughout. Issued as volume 14 of the unspeakable visions of the individual series of publications about the Beats.
